Aerobic Septic Installation in Denver, CO

Aerobic septic installation services involve setting up advanced wastewater treatment systems that use oxygen-rich environments to break down waste more effectively. These systems are commonly used for residential properties where traditional septic tanks may not be suitable or where higher treatment levels are desired. Projects can include new installations for homes, upgrades to existing septic systems, or replacements for outdated equipment. Property owners often want to understand the specific requirements for their site, including space needs, soil conditions, and local regulations, to ensure the system functions properly and meets health standards.

Before requesting aerobic septic installation services, homeowners should consider factors such as the size of their property, the number of occupants, and the intended use of the system. It’s important to evaluate whether the property’s terrain and soil composition support an aerobic system and to clarify any local permitting or inspection requirements. Understanding these details helps ensure the chosen system is appropriate, compliant, and effective for long-term wastewater management.

Aerobic Septic Installation Questions

What is an aerobic septic system? An aerobic septic system uses oxygen to treat wastewater, providing a more efficient alternative to traditional systems for homes and properties.

What types of properties typically need aerobic septic installation? Properties with limited space, poor soil absorption, or those requiring higher treatment levels often opt for aerobic systems.

How does aerobic septic installation improve wastewater treatment? It introduces oxygen into the treatment process, promoting faster breakdown of waste and reducing odors.

What should property owners consider before installing an aerobic septic system? Factors include property size, soil conditions, and local regulations to ensure proper system selection and placement.
